The Greens stand behind family violence, public safety and health advocates calls for firearms reform which properly protects the community through prevention.

These organisations are on the frontline, dealing with the heavy impacts of unlimited firearms in the Tasmanian community. They see the injuries and deaths, threats and coercive control, and trauma caused by firearms.

The Liberals should be acting on the expert advice and evidence presented by these advocacy groups in the name of public safety instead of pandering to the gun lobby.

The groups have called for real action to reduce the number of firearms in Tasmania. This means caps and not grandfathering reclassification amendments.

The Greens are committed to working with community stakeholders and across the Parliament to reform firearms laws in the interests of public safety – not the gun lobby.
